回顾你之前在软考网络规划、算法、C++底层以及Linux云计算方面的深入探索,其实已经构建起了一个非常宏伟的“技术骨架”。而Python的学习,恰恰是为这副骨架填充血肉、赋予灵动的执行能力的关键一步。对于“零基础系统化学Python”这门课程,其价值不仅仅在于入门一门新语言,更在于它是通往AI编程世界的必经之路。
以下是关于Python系统化学习的深度解析:
一、 编程思维的重塑:从严谨控制到高效表达 对于习惯了C++严谨类型检查和底层内存控制的你来说,接触Python的第一感觉往往是“轻盈”。Python的设计哲学是“优雅”与“明确”,它去掉了繁琐的语法外壳,让开发者能将精力集中在解决问题的逻辑本身,而非语言的实现细节上。
这种转变实际上是一种思维维度的升级。在AI编程领域,我们更需要快速验证想法、构建模型原型。Python的简洁性极大地降低了这种“思维到代码”的转化成本,让你能像写伪代码一样流畅地编程。这种“快速表达”的能力,是现代高效工程师的必备素养。
二、 系统化学习:拒绝碎片化的知识拼凑 市面上Python教程繁多,但“零基础系统化”课程的独特之处在于其严谨的知识图谱。它不是零散语法的堆砌,而是从数据结构、控制流、函数封装到面向对象编程的层层递进。
系统化学习能帮你建立起清晰的“代码地图”。你会明白为什么在数据处理时要用列表推导式,为什么要用装饰器来扩展功能。这种扎实的基础训练,能让你在面对后续复杂的AI框架时,不再因为语法卡顿而中断逻辑思考,为进阶学习扫清障碍。
三、 数据视角的构建:AI时代的通用语言 Python之所以能成为AI领域的霸主,核心在于其对数据处理的天然亲和力。课程中对于序列、字典以及高级数据处理库的学习,本质上是在培养一种“数据思维”。
在AI编程中,一切皆数据。你需要学会像操作水流一样操作数据流——清洗、转换、分发。Python强大的生态系统(如NumPy、Pandas)提供了处理海量数据的工具箱,而这些工具箱的钥匙,正是Python语言本身。掌握它,你就拿到了开启AI数据大门的通行证。
四、 工程落地的桥梁:连接算法理论与实际应用 理论模型再完美,最终都需要落地为可运行的代码。Python正是连接算法理论与实际应用的桥梁。无论是调用TensorFlow构建神经网络,还是编写脚本自动化运维,Python都能完美胜任。
结合你已有的Linux SRE和架构背景,学习Python意味着你不再局限于“看懂”算法,而是具备了“实现”算法的能力。你可以编写自动化脚本来管理云资源,或者部署AI模型到生产环境。这种将理论转化为生产力的能力,正是从“学习者”向“创造者”转变的核心标志。












评论(0)